Development of Inter-Parliamentary Cooperation To Be Discussed at Meeting of Council of CIS Heads of State

A regular meeting of the Council of Permanent Plenipotentiary Representatives of CIS Member Nations at Statutory and Other Bodies took place in the CIS Executive Committee in Minsk.

Representative of the IPA CIS Council Secretariat at the CIS Executive Committee Igor Borovko took part in the meeting on behalf of the IPA CIS.

The meeting elaborated the draft agendas of the regular meeting of the Council of the CIS Foreign Ministers and the Council of the CIS Heads of State to take place in Tashkent on 15 and 16 October respectively.

The participants were also briefed on the activities of the CIS Advisory Board on Cooperation in the Field of Public Health and discussed the situation related to the spread of COVID-19 infection in the CIS. They noted the important role of the Advisory Board in the development of the CIS interaction in the field of preserving, restoring and improving the health of the population, providing medical assistance to citizens and ensuring sanitary and epidemiological wellness, developing and strengthening interstate relations in the medical field.

Besides, the meeting approved the Joint Action Plan of the CIS Executive Committee, the Council of Permanent and Plenipotentiary Representatives and the Economic Policies Commission at the CIS Economic Council for the implementation of the decisions of the meeting of the Council of CIS Heads of Government, which took place in May, as well as the proposals of the heads of delegations.

The members of the Council were also presented with the interim results of the implementation of the Concept of the Presidency of the Republic of Uzbekistan in the CIS in 2020 and the Action Plan for its implementation.

The meeting also considered the issue of the Head of the CIS Observer Mission at the Presidential Elections in the Republic of Belarus on 9 August 2020. The Mission will be headed by Chairman of the CIS Executive Committee Sergey Lebedev.
